How they compare
Viet Nam currently reports 3.7% against 3.7% in Syrian Arab Republic, a difference of 0.0%.
Across all 30 years both countries report, Viet Nam has been ahead every year.
Syrian Arab Republic ranks 121st and Viet Nam ranks 120th of 179 countries.
Viet Nam has averaged higher in every one of the 4 decades both report.
Head to head by decade
| Decade | Syrian Arab Republic | Viet Nam |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 2.8% | 5.0% | 2.2% | Viet Nam |
| 2000s | 3.6% | 4.0% | 0.3% | Viet Nam |
| 2010s | 3.7% | 3.7% | 0.1% | Viet Nam |
| 2020s | 3.7% | 3.7% | 0.1% | Viet Nam |
Averages of every year both report within each decade.

About this data
Industrial water withdrawals as a percentage of total water withdrawals (which is the sum of water used for agriculture, industry, and municipal purposes).
